Saron Chapel (welsh Calvinistic Methodist), Cwm-twrch

6301 ·

Saron Chapel was built in 1838 and rebuilt in 1876 in the Sub-Classical style of the gable entry type.

Beula Welsh Independent Chapel (beulah), Penrhosgarnedd, Bangor

6690 ·

Beula Independent Chapel was built in 1836 and rebuilt in 1872. The present chapel, dated 1872, is built in the Simple Round-Headed, style of the gable-entry type.

Seion Welsh Baptist Chapel, Bangor Rd./st David’s Rd., Penmaenmawr

6838 ·

Seion Baptist Chapel was built in 1895 in the Vernacular style of the gable entry type. By 1996 the chapel building was in use as a workshop.

Maesydref Independent Chapel, Clwt-y-bont, Deiniolen, Llanberis

6934 ·

Maesydref Independent Chapel was built in 1879 in the Sub-Classical style of the gable entry type. By 1997 Maesydref had fallen into disuse.

Bethel (2) Chapel (welsh Calvinistic Methodist), High Street, Smelt, Coedpoeth

7475 ·

Bethel Methodist Chapel was built in 1859 and rebuilt in 1878 in the Sub-Classical style of the gable entry type.
